– List of required ingredients with quantities
To create a sweet and tangy glaze for your grilled salmon fillets, gather the following ingredients:
1. 1/4 cup honey
2. 1/4 cup soy sauce
3. 2 cloves garlic, minced
4. 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
5. 2 tablespoons rice vinegar
6. 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
7. 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
8. Salt and pepper to taste
In a small saucepan, combine honey, soy sauce, garlic, ginger, rice vinegar, and Dijon mustard. Heat over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the honey is fully dissolved. Once the mixture comes to a gentle simmer, add the melted butter and continue to cook for another 2-3 minutes, or until slightly thickened. Season with salt and pepper to taste before brushing the glaze over your grilled salmon fillets.
– Steps to marinate the salmon fillets
To create a mouthwatering BBQ salmon recipe with a sweet and tangy glaze, start by preparing your salmon fillets for grilling. First, pat the fillets dry with paper towels to ensure they’re absorbent-free before marinating. In a shallow dish or ziplock bag, combine your favorite marinade ingredients such as olive oil, soy sauce, honey, Dijon mustard, minced garlic, salt, and pepper. Add the salmon fillets to the marinade, ensuring each side is thoroughly coated. Seal the bag tightly (or cover the dish) and let it marinate in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es – the longer it soaks up the flavors, the better. After marinading, preheat your grill to medium-high heat, allowing it to reach a nice sear temperature before placing the salmon on the grill grates.
